A $19,200 total commission is split 50/50 between the listing and selling brokerages, and the listing salesperson keeps 60% of their brokerage's share. How much does that salesperson earn?
a.$9,600
b.$5,760
c.$11,520
d.$3,840
Giải thích
Each brokerage gets 50% of $19,200 = $9,600. The listing salesperson keeps 60% of $9,600 = $5,760, and the brokerage keeps the remaining 40%. Commission splits are set by the agreement between broker and salesperson.
